Ubiquitin tagging allows the 19S subunit of the 26S proteasome to recognize the potential protein substrate.
Proteasomes are protein complexes. These protein complexes are present in eukaryotes, some bacteria and in archaea. The proteasomes are located in the nucleus and the cytoplasm when looking at eukaryotes.
